FuboTV & NBC Team Up For The 2018 Winter Olympics

Group of young people watching soccer matchToday fuboTV and NBCUniversal announced a new deal to stream over 2,400 hours of the 2018 Winter Olympics in PyeongChang, South Korea.

Subscribers to the fuboTV will have access to NBCUniversal’s 2,400 hours of Olympic programming, including coverage of all competition events live and on-demand. fuboTV has also today launched a new feature, updating its Sports navigation bar to include a break-down of Olympic programming, sorted by sport, in order to help viewers find specific live events more easily.

“The Winter Olympics is a great example of the breadth and depth of live sports that our subscribers can stream, with thousands of hours of premium content available this month thanks to our partnership with NBCUniversal,” said fuboTV Head of Content Strategy & Acquisition Ben Grad.  “Sports fans demand access to the best sports moments, athletes and teams across their favorite devices, and we can’t wait to deliver that experience to them when the PyeongChang Games begin on Thursday.”

fuboTV subscribers will also be able to log into the NBC Sports app and NBCOlympics.com to access 18000 hours of Olympic live streaming and digital-only content on their PCs, mobile devices, tablets, and connected TVs.

The 2018 Winter Olympics kick off tomorrow February 8th and run through the 25th of February.
